National Conference (NC) president Farooq Abdullah today (April 25) said that the I.N.D.I.A bloc is fighting against Prime Minister Narendra Modi's attempts to create a rift among people and the opposition alliance will undo the wrongdoings committed during the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) rule.
"The Election Commission (EC) has to be changed and made independent. The judiciary has to be made independent as it is the place where people get justice if they do not get justice anywhere else.
"Many things have to be set right. Those have to be made governors who can serve people and not Delhi. Many incapable people have been put in many institutions, but we have to save those institutions," he said.Abdullah was addressing an NC and Congress joint rally at Congress party headquarters and later NC workers at his party's headquarters Nawa-i-Subah after its candidate from Srinagar Lok Sabha constituency, Aga Syed Ruhullah Mehdi, submitted nomination papers.
"I pray that the I.N.D.I.A alliance is successful in Delhi so that Ambedkar's Constitution is saved and it will undo the wrongdoings committed," the former J-K chief minister said.
Abdullah claimed that the Constitution was in danger.
"You saw what the prime minister said in Rajasthan. He tried to shred the Indian Constitution into pieces. The Indian Constitution provides dignity to everyone," Abdullah said.
"The PM of the country has to speak for all and has to protect all. He is like a father. He should not differentiate between people on religious lines or food habits or languages.
He has to serve everyone whether they belong to his party or not," he said and expressed disappointment at Modi's speech.Abdullah alleged Modi wanted to "break the country and separate people on the religious lines".
"He (Modi) wants to create a rift among the people. The I.N.D.I.A alliance is fighting against that. The I.N.D.I.A alliance wants to keep the country united and safeguard Ambedkar's constitution," he added.
The former Union minister said, "A movement will start from this crown (J-K) which will change the seat of power in Delhi and bring a revolution in the country."
"The BJP wants to dictate to the people what to eat or wear. They want everyone to be like them. They want to tell you which God to pray to, they want to wipe out everything," he alleged.
